To play Myles Brennan or not to play him? That is the question before LSU coach Ed Orgeron and offensive coordinator Steve Ensminger on Saturday night against Southeastern Louisiana.
It has been said since Joe Burrow arrived on the South Louisiana scene this summer and made his seemingly inevitable march on the starting quarterback job that LSU should redshirt Brennan if it can. That is, if Burrow plays well enough and stays healthy enough that Brennan can still have three remaining seasons of eligibility starting in 2019.
Orgeron does not appear to be in that camp. Treading a careful line between expressing his private thoughts and not wanting to disrespect his opponent, Coach O said he would like to play Brennan on Saturday if he can.
